public interface RuleViewHelperService
Boolean validateRule(RuleEditor rule)
Boolean validateProposition(PropositionEditor proposition)
void resetDescription(PropositionEditor proposition)
void buildActions(RuleEditor rule)
void configurePropositionForType(PropositionEditor proposition)
TemplateInfo getTemplateForType(String type)
void refreshInitTrees(RuleEditor rule)
void refreshViewTree(RuleEditor rule)
Tree<CompareTreeNode,String> buildCompareTree(RuleEditor original, RuleEditor compare)
Tree<CompareTreeNode,String> buildMultiViewTree(RuleEditor coRuleEditor, RuleEditor cluRuleEditor)
Boolean compareRules(RuleEditor original)
void initPropositionEditor(PropositionEditor propositionEditor)
void finPropositionEditor(PropositionEditor propositionEditor)
Map<String,String> getTermParameters(PropositionEditor proposition)
PropositionEditor copyProposition(PropositionEditor proposition)
PropositionEditor createCompoundPropositionBoStub(PropositionEditor existing, boolean addNewChild)
void setTypeForCompoundOpCode(PropositionEditor proposition, String compoundOpCode)
PropositionEditor createSimplePropositionBoStub(PropositionEditor sibling)
Boolean compareProposition(PropositionEditor original, PropositionEditor compare)
Boolean compareCompoundProposition(List<PropositionEditor> original, List<PropositionEditor> compare)
Boolean compareTerm(List<TermParameterEditor> original, List<TermParameterEditor> compare)
Copyright © 2004–2014 The Kuali Foundation. All rights reserved.